CNN reported that a CNN/ORC International nationwide poll found 48% of voters who watched the vice presidential debate Thursday thought Congressman Paul Ryan won, awhile 44% gave the win to Vice President Joe Biden.

Half of the debate watchers in the survey said the encounter didn’t make them more likely to vote for either of the tickets, 28% said it made them favor Romney, 21% said it made them choose Obama.

As to viewer expectations: 55% said Biden did better than expected, and 51% said Ryan did better than expected.

A CBS News poll of uncommitted voters who watched the debate favored Biden over Ryan by a 50%-31% margin. Roughly 10% of the debate audience were uncommitted.
